UMBILICAL CORD BLOOD STEM CELL COLLECTION Families are frequently requesting information on umbilical cord blood stem cell collection at the time of birth. Less than 1% of patients delivering at Norwest Private request that the cord blood be collected for storage and future potential use (possibly in an ill family member). I would remind patients of the RANZCOG and AAP statements on this practice which suggest it has limited usefulness. It is recommended that expectant families only consider private cord banking when they have a relative with a known disorder that is treatable by stem cell transplants. Studies to date (and data from the private storage companies themselves) show that the chance of a child being able to use his / her own cord blood is extremely small - from a 1:400 to 1:200,000 chance over the childs lifetime.
